在地图上编程的软件有什么
-
在地图上编程的软件主要有以下几种:
-
Google地图API:Google地图API是一种用于在网站或应用程序中嵌入地图的工具。它提供了一系列接口和功能,使开发者能够在地图上显示标记、绘制路径、计算距离等操作。
-
Mapbox:Mapbox是一种开源地图平台,提供了丰富的地图数据和工具。开发者可以使用Mapbox的API来创建自定义地图,并在地图上添加自己的数据和样式。
-
Leaflet:Leaflet是一个轻量级的JavaScript库,用于在网页上创建交互式地图。它支持多种地图提供商,包括Google地图、Mapbox和OpenStreetMap等。
-
OpenLayers:OpenLayers是一个开源的JavaScript库,用于在网页上创建交互式地图。它支持多种地图投影和数据格式,并提供了丰富的地图操作功能。
-
ArcGIS API for JavaScript:ArcGIS API for JavaScript是Esri提供的一种用于在网页上创建地图应用的工具。它支持多种地图服务和数据格式,并提供了强大的地图分析和可视化功能。
这些地图编程软件提供了丰富的功能和接口,可以帮助开发者在地图上实现各种交互和数据展示需求。无论是开发网站、移动应用还是地理信息系统,这些软件都是非常有用的工具。
1年前 -
-
在地图上编程的软件有很多,以下是其中一些常用的地图编程软件:
-
Google Maps API:Google Maps API 是一个开发者工具包,可以使用 JavaScript、Python、Java 和其他编程语言来构建自定义地图应用程序。它提供了丰富的功能,包括地图显示、地理编码、路径规划和地图标记等。
-
Leaflet:Leaflet 是一个开源的 JavaScript 库,用于在网页上创建交互式地图。它轻巧、灵活,并支持各种地图图层、标记和图形。Leaflet 支持多种地图提供商,如 Google Maps、Mapbox 和 OpenStreetMap。
-
Mapbox:Mapbox 是一个地图平台,提供了一套开发者工具和 API,用于构建地图应用程序。它支持自定义地图样式、地图标记、路径规划和地理编码等功能。Mapbox 还提供了一些开源的地图库,如 Mapbox GL JS 和 Mapbox iOS SDK。
-
ArcGIS API for JavaScript:ArcGIS API for JavaScript 是 Esri 公司提供的一个 JavaScript 库,用于在网页上构建地图应用程序。它提供了丰富的地图功能,包括地图显示、地理编码、路径规划和地图分析等。ArcGIS API for JavaScript 还支持 2D 和 3D 地图的展示。
-
OpenLayers:OpenLayers 是一个开源的 JavaScript 库,用于在网页上创建交互式地图。它支持各种地图图层、标记和图形,并提供了丰富的地图功能,如地理编码、路径规划和地图样式定制等。
这些地图编程软件都提供了丰富的功能和灵活的定制选项,使开发者能够根据自己的需求构建出各种各样的地图应用程序。无论是构建简单的地图显示还是复杂的地图分析应用,这些软件都能提供强大的支持。
1年前 -
-
在地图上编程的软件主要包括地理信息系统(GIS)软件和地图开发平台。这些软件提供了丰富的工具和功能,可以进行地图数据的处理、分析、可视化和应用开发等操作。
下面将介绍几种常用的地图编程软件:
-
ArcGIS:ArcGIS是ESRI公司开发的一套全球领先的GIS软件,提供了强大的地图制作、数据编辑、空间分析和应用开发等功能。通过ArcGIS,用户可以对地图数据进行编辑、管理和分析,构建专业的地图应用和空间分析模型。
-
QGIS:QGIS是一款开源的GIS软件,提供了类似ArcGIS的功能,可以进行地图制作、数据编辑、空间分析和应用开发等操作。QGIS具有友好的用户界面和丰富的插件支持,广泛应用于各个领域的地理信息工作。
-
Google Earth Engine:Google Earth Engine是谷歌提供的一套云平台,用于进行地理空间数据的存储、处理和分析。它集成了大量的卫星影像数据和地理数据,提供了强大的分析功能和API接口,方便用户进行地图编程和应用开发。
-
Leaflet:Leaflet是一款轻量级的JavaScript地图库,适用于在网页上展示交互式地图。它提供了简单易用的API接口和丰富的地图插件,可以快速构建自定义地图应用。Leaflet支持多种地图数据源,包括OpenStreetMap、Google Maps和ArcGIS等。
-
Mapbox:Mapbox是一家提供地图开发平台和地理数据的公司,其产品包括Mapbox Studio、Mapbox GL JS和Mapbox SDK等。Mapbox提供了丰富的地图样式和可视化效果,可以进行地图定制和交互式应用开发。
总之,地图编程软件提供了丰富的功能和工具,可以帮助用户进行地图数据的处理、分析和应用开发等操作。不同的软件适用于不同的需求和应用场景,用户可以根据自己的需求选择合适的软件进行地图编程。
1年前 -